在Linux中,通过Telnet管理网络设备是一种常见的远程管理方法。以下是详细步骤:
首先,确保你的Linux系统上安装了Telnet客户端。大多数Linux发行版默认已经安装了Telnet客户端,但如果没有,可以使用以下命令进行安装:
sudo apt-get install telnet # Debian/Ubuntu
sudo yum install telnet # CentOS/RHEL
sudo dnf install telnet # Fedora
在Linux系统上,Telnet服务通常不是默认启动的。你需要手动启动它。以下是启动Telnet服务的命令:
sudo systemctl start telnet.socket
sudo systemctl enable telnet.socket # 设置开机自启动
确保防火墙允许Telnet流量通过。以下是一些常见的防火墙配置命令:
iptablessudo iptables -A INPUT -p tcp --dport 23 -j ACCEPT
firewalldsudo firewall-cmd --permanent --add-service=telnet
sudo firewall-cmd --reload
使用Telnet客户端连接到目标网络设备。以下是连接命令:
telnet <设备IP地址> <端口号>
例如,连接到IP地址为192.168.1.1的设备:
telnet 192.168.1.1 23
输入设备的用户名和密码进行登录。登录成功后,你将进入设备的命令行界面。
在设备的命令行界面中,你可以执行各种管理命令,如配置接口、查看状态、重启设备等。
完成管理任务后,可以通过输入exit命令退出Telnet会话。
通过以上步骤,你可以在Linux系统中通过Telnet管理网络设备。